Evil Empire smirk at predictions, come back to defeat Dak To The Future in 147.00-146.18 squeaker
Evil Empire brought their A game and outperformed expectations, coming from behind for a 147.00-146.18 win over Dak To The Future. Evil Empire trailed 146.18-116.50 heading into Monday night, but the team charged back behind the Los Angeles Chargers defense (3 Pts Allowed, 173 Yds Allowed, 3 Turnovers) and Justin Herbert (235 Pass Yds). Dak Prescott (347 Pass Yds, 3 Pass TDs, 41 Rush Yds) and Saquon Barkley (84 Rush Yds, 1 Rush TD, 49 Rec Yds) did their part for Dak To The Future in the loss. This marks the first time this season Evil Empire have gotten the best of Dak To The Future, after falling 176.3-58.3 in their last matchup. Evil Empire improve to 8-7 for the season, while Dak To The Future fall to 6-10.
